ALLAMUCHY SCHOOL PTO MEETING MINUTES – November 16, 2017

Paula Waeschle,President, called the meeting to order at 6:35 p.m. in Room 149 at the Allamuchy Township School.

Present: 12 members were present, including 6 officers.

Treasurer's Report

Tiffany Ulch, Treasurer, presented the Treasurer's Report

Tiffany discussed balance as of 11/16 $35,442.16

Motion to accept: Melinda Freedley

Second: Mariam Andalibi

Motion Carried

Secretary’s Report

Jennifer Nascimento, Secretary, presented minutes from 9/21/17 meeting

2 Thank you notes presented

Motion to accept: Melinda Freedley

Second: Mariam Andalibi

Motion Carried

New Business

A. Grant Requests

  1. Michelle Stassi(2nd Grade/Resource)/ Sarah Mikaliunas(PSD) requested Laminating Sheets 2 boxes for each teacher $93.54
  2. Michelle Stassi (2nd Grade) Black Lagoon Chapter Book set $40.
  3. Sarah Mikaliunas (special Ed resource room) Various book for transitioning new students $12, Pocket Foam Blocks $19.95, CD Player $24.99,

Motion to accept: Fran Muhlenbruch

Second: Tiffany Ulch

Motion Carried

B. Holiday Shoppe-still in need of Chairperson for 2018. Melinda Freedley offered to chair. She will reach out to Gina current chair to work out transition

C. Paula presented Scrip Gift Card Fundraiser. Paula will Chair. On line only event. Flyers to go home. Big Facebook push.

D. Fundraiser ideas for the rest of the year discussed. Future discussions needed.

Old Business

  1. Battle of the Books Teams-$200 each team-Paige to follow up with teams
  2. Book Fair-Lori will follow up w possibility of combining Fall/Holiday book fairs and see if we have earned enough to still give Buy One Get One Fair in June

Committee Reports

Trunk or Treat- Jen Nascimento advised it was held on Friday Oct 29 at MVS. Huge success. 250 kids and 37 trunks participated. Fran Muhlenbruch/Paige Schmiedekecoordinated Peanut Free options for all trunks.

Open Discussion/Idea Exchange/Suggestions

Tabitha Dombroski advised that 10 Engineers from Picatinny have been background checked and provide and fund a STEM assembly. Jen Gallegly is working w Tabitha to move this forward.

Secretary will ensure minutes and agenda will be posted prior to next meeting

Paige advised Jim McCloskey, Author in Residence, will present “We Dig Worms” for MtnVilla in Late Spring. Holly Guido will find presenters for grades 3-5 and 6-8 @ATS

Adjournment

Meeting was adjourned at 7:50p.m by Paula Waeschle
